What Causes Your Feet To Swell When You Sit For Prolonged Time?

A lot of people experience swelling in their feet when they sit for prolonged periods of time. It happens when excess fluid accumulates in the cells and tissues of the feet which causes discomfort, pain and also difficulty in walking. This could happen due to various reasons. If you’re someone who suffers from the issue, it is important that you seek medical advice since this could also be a sign of major health issues like diabetes or heart disease. Therefore, you shouldn’t ignore if you have swollen feet.

Here, take a look at the different reasons that might cause your feet to swell when sitting for a prolonged period of time.

Gravity
When you sit for prolonged periods of time, gravity can cause your blood to flow to your lower extremities, especially in your feet and legs. This can cause pressure within the blood vessels, pushing out fluids into the surrounding cells and tissues. This eventually causes swelling or oedema.
Poor Circulation
When you sit for a long time, especially in constricted positions, it can affect the way the blood returns to the heart. This poor circulation can cause blood to accumulate in the veins of your feet and legs, thereby, increasing pressure within the veins and causing. This eventually causes the swelling.
Excess Salt
Consuming foods that are high in sodium can lead to water retention, which can aggravate swelling in the body. When you sit for a prolonged period of time, it affects your body’s ability to manage fluid balance, thereby, causing swelling in the body. This is also called salt-induced water retention.
Heart Conditions
Heart diseases, such as congestive heart failure, can affect the heart’s ability to circulate blood. When the heart doesn’t pump blood, fluid can back up in the legs and feet, causing swelling.
Kidney Disease
The kidneys play an important role in balancing fluid and electrolytes in the body. Kidney diseases can affect this balance, leading to fluid retention, which causes swelling in the feet and ankles, which becomes worse when you sit for a long time.
Liver Disease
Liver diseases like cirrhosis can lead to a decrease in the production of albumin, which is important for maintaining blood pressure and keeping fluid in the vessels. Low albumin levels can lead to fluid leakage into the surrounding cells and tissue, causing swelling.
Blood Clots
De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is a serious condition in which blood clots form in the deep veins of the legs. This blocks the flow of blood and causes swelling in the legs. Sitting for prolonged periods can increase the risk of DVT, thereby causing swelling.
Pregnancy
During pregnancy, there are hormonal changes and the increased size of the uterus can add pressure on veins in the pelvis, affecting blood flow from the lower limbs. This effect increases when you’re sitting for extended periods, causing swelling in the feet and ankles.
Medications
Certain medications, such as steroids and NSAIDs can cause swelling in the feet and legs. These medicines can affect kidney function and fluid balance or directly cause vascular leakage.
